At this class you will be learning the traditional leaded method and you will be making a panel that is approximately an A4 size, I will have some nice templates for you to use which will be perfect and you will go home with it that day ! I have a nice selection of coloured glass which will mean you will have a nice balance for your panel. You will learn to cut glass, assemble, lead, and solder and voila! you will have something lovely you will definitely be proud of . There is a limit of 5 people per class, which enables individual tuition, and each student will take home something wonderful that they have created and will have had lots of informative tuition which should be enough for you to go home and set up for practice.
